Python Merge Two Lists Without Duplicates Using Set Union
In this example, below Python code, two lists, `list1` and `list2`, are merged without duplicates by converting them into sets (`set1` and `set2`). The union of these sets is then obtained and converted back into a list (`ans`), resulting in a merged list free of duplicate elements.
Python3
list1 = [ 23 , 45 , 65 , 31 , 1 , 89 ] list2 = [ 67 , 89 , 23 , 45 , 8 , 90 ] # Converting the list into set set1 = set (list1) set2 = set (list2) # find the union of the sets and converting resultant set to list ans = list (set1.union(set2)) print ( "The resultant merged list is " ) print (ans) |
The resultant merged list is [65, 1, 67, 8, 45, 23, 89, 90, 31]
Python Merge Two Lists Without Duplicates Using For Loop
In this example, below Python code snippet, two lists, `list1` and `list2`, are merged without duplicates using a manual approach. The code iterates through each element in both lists, checking for duplicates and appending unique elements to the resultant list `ans`.
Python3
list1 = [ 23 , 45 , 65 , 31 , 1 , 89 ] list2 = [ 67 , 89 , 23 , 45 , 8 , 90 ] # Resultant list ans = [] # Traversing the list item one by one for data in list1: if data not in ans: ans.append(data) for data in list2: if data not in ans: ans.append(data) print ( "The resultant merged list is " ) print (ans) |
The resultant merged list is [23, 45, 65, 31, 1, 89, 67, 8, 90]
Python Merge Two Lists Without Duplicates Using list() Method
In this example, below Python code merges two lists, `list1` and `list2`, without duplicates. It uses the set union operation to combine the elements of both lists, and then converts the resulting set back into a list (`ans`).
Python3
list1 = [ 23 , 45 , 65 , 31 , 1 , 89 ] list2 = [ 67 , 89 , 23 , 45 , 8 , 90 ] # Resultant list ans = list ( set (list1 + list2)) print ( "The resultant merged list is " ) print (ans) |
The resultant merged list is [65, 1, 67, 8, 45, 23, 89, 90, 31]
Python Merge Two Lists Without Duplicates Using list comprehension
In this example, below Python code efficiently merges two lists, `list1` and `list2`, without duplicates. It creates the resultant list (`ans`) by combining `list1` with elements from `list2` that are not already present in `list1`.
Python3
list1 = [ 23 , 45 , 65 , 31 , 1 , 89 ] list2 = [ 67 , 89 , 23 , 45 , 8 , 90 ] # Resultant list ans = list1 + [data for data in list2 if data not in list1] print ( "The resultant merged list is " ) print (ans) |
The resultant merged list is [23, 45, 65, 31, 1, 89, 67, 8, 90]
